The Discovery of the Higgs Boson

The Higgs Boson is a special particle in physics. Scientists believed it existed for many years because it helps explain why other particles have mass. Mass is what makes things heavy or light. Without the Higgs Boson, particles would not have mass, and everything would float in space.

In 2012, scientists at CERN, a large research center in Switzerland, discovered the Higgs Boson. They used a big machine called the Large Hadron Collider (LHC) to smash particles together at very high speeds. By studying the results of these collisions, they found evidence of the Higgs Boson. This discovery was very important because it confirmed a key part of the Standard Model, which is a theory that explains how particles and forces work in the universe. Finding the Higgs Boson helped scientists understand more about the building blocks of everything around us.
